CINE 320 Intermediate Cinematography Building upon the foundational skills learned in earlier cinematography courses, this class continues the discovery and experimentation of camera and lighting techniques through a complex and refined lens. The course focuses on the visual image and how to arrive at that through mental and physical means. Students will deepen their understanding of cameras, lenses, lighting design, and composition, while applying these concepts to more advanced cinematic scenarios. This course emphasizes the development of technical knowledge and creativity, encouraging students to experiment with a wider range of equipment, lighting setups, and stylistic choices. Through hands-on projects, collaborative exercises and critical analysis, students will gain the skills necessary to elevate and expand their visual storytelling.
Repeatable: N Prerequisites CINE 210 The Production Team and CINE 220 Cinematography: Camera and Lighting Concepts
Minimum Credits 3 Maximum Credits 3
